STUDY ON THE RESOURCE AND ENVIRONMENTAL ATTRIBUTION APPRAISAL MODEL OF PRODUCTION PROCESS BASED ON D

  Production process of manufacturing enterprise,which directly consumes resource and causes environmental pollution,is an important stage in product life cycle.For the diversification of manufacturing processes and complexity of environmental impact factor,it still lacks effective method for environmental impact appraisal of product production process.In this paper,a evaluate index system based on process IPO model and a kind of resource and environmental attribution appraisal model based on the data envelopment analytic method (DEA) for production process are established.This model regards each possible manufacture unit as decision-making unit in DEA,introduces the quantity of pollutant in the appraisal model as one kind of inputs,and quantitatively appraises resource and environmental attribution of production process.A case study of valve body manufacturing is discussed,which confirmed the validity and feasibility of the method and model.
